## Lease Renegotiation — Thornquay Office (Managers Only)

Quick update for heads of department: we've reopened talks with Ambervale Properties on the Thornquay lease. Their first counter keeps the base rent flat but trims the fit-out allowance, which isn't great given the planned lab expansion. Priya thinks we can squeeze a break clause at year five if we commit early. Don't mention any of this to the floor teams yet — it could unsettle the relocation rumours. Relevant planning detail follows below.

confidential, bahof-yaweg: Headcount on the Kaseth team goes from 32 to 109 by the end of January. Gross margin on Kaseth came in at 46 percent against a plan of 45 percent.

Hey — handing off the Copperfen inventory reconciliation job before my rotation ends. It runs nightly, diffs warehouse counts against ledger totals, and flags mismatches above the threshold. Nothing scary, but the security review should confirm the job only reads the two scoped datasets. The values it currently runs with are listed below.

settings of kagup-tagug:
ULAIX_HOST=ulaix.zemvarsys.internal
ULAIX_PORT=8000

Ticket #4182 — Signature check failing on Glacierbin archive jobs

Hey, whoever's on call: the nightly job that archives cold storage buckets into Glacierbin started bombing out around 02:10. Every manifest fails verification, so nothing's been sealed since Tuesday. Pretty sure the verifier got updated last sprint and nobody re-signed the archiver image. The fix is just re-signing and re-pushing — takes ten minutes. For reference, the key the verifier currently trusts is below.

rollout seal: bky4_x7Gc

**CI note: Cron drift on the Bramwell schedulers**

Support team: jobs on the Bramwell cluster are firing up to ninety seconds late after the clock-sync agent restart. This is drift, not job failure — advise customers no data was lost. Reruns are queued automatically. To match customer reports against our logs, use the trace token below.

pipeline stamp: htk9_ce63042d9